Massive explosion in Nushki-Dalbandin highway claims 5 lives

NUSHKI: A horrible explosion on the Naushki-Dalbandin Highway in Balochistan on Sunday caused the death of at least five and left ten others injured.

According to the officials, the explosion struck a bus travelling from  Nushki to Taftan. Rescue teams swiftly arrived at the site to carry the injured and dead to the hospital.

Further medical assistance is being provided to the injured people in the Nushki hospital to ensure their quick recovery.

In the light of the recent terrorist activities in Balochistan, the Medical Superintendent of Mir Gul Khan Naseer Teaching Hospital in Noshki declared an emergency to cope with the hastening influx of casualties.

Meanwhile, security forces have cordoned off the blast site, and investigations are underway to determine the cause and those responsible for the attack.

In another, separate event, an explosion near a police mobile in the Kirani Road area of Quetta left six people injured while a policeman was martyred.

The injured are being provided with immediate medical relief, while law enforcement agencies have cordoned off the area to start an inquiry.

Provincial Government Spokesman Shahid Rind confirmed the incident, further adding that emergency services remained on high alert.

These latest incidents have taken place following the hijacking of the Jaffar Express train in Balochistan and a subsequent high-stakes standoff between the Baloch Liberation Army and Pakistani security forces.
